#47278c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47278c is composed of 27.8% red, 15.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 72.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 259 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 35.1%. #47278c color hex could be obtained by blending #8e4eff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#47278c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47278c has RGB values of R:71, G:39,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4663180.

Shades and Tints of #47278c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#47278c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59575c is the less saturated color, while #3a05ae is the most saturated one.
